Bill Jones at Home - Indigenous Person with Tipi Native American Indian - 1909 Miles City Cancel - RPPC Postcard SP24
Scene Details:
- Real photo postcard (RPPC-style) captioned "179 BILL JONES AT HOME."
- Indigenous person identified as Bill Jones standing beside a white canvas tipi on open grassland
- Subject holds a tall staff and wears a striped blanket wrap, beaded necklace with large disc pendant, and traditional dress
- Open prairie landscape, likely Miles City, Montana area, c.1909
Postal Markings:
- Divided back, publisher: Matteson Post Cards, R. Steinman, Publisher, St. Paul, Minn., no. 179
- Green 1¢ Benjamin Franklin stamp (Series 1902)
- Circular postmark: Miles City, Jan [1909]
- Handwritten message: "Miles City Jan 5-09 / Dear Berthie, I thank you so much for my Xmas package which I received on Xmas Eve. I will soon be home now. Hope you are all well. With love from all and a Happy New Year."
- Addressed: Miss Bertha Buegel, Oconomowoc, Wis., Fowler St. — used/mailed
